Can you damage an oscilloscope?

For example, the warning label on the front panel of the oscilloscope indicates the maximum input level. Do not exceed the stated voltage. Avoid damage by being prepared with some idea of the signal level to be connected with the oscilloscope. Overdriving the inputs can damage the front-end components.

Can I connect the oscilloscope anywhere in the circuit?

An oscilloscope has a probe, and a ground clip. The ground clip should be connected to the circuit’s reference ground, 0V, earth, or whatever the manufacturer has deemed it. The probe goes to wherever you want to look at.

Is it possible to directly measure the AC voltage across a resistor using the digital oscilloscope explain why or why not?

Question 11. Most oscilloscopes can only directly measure voltage, not current. One way to measure AC current with an oscilloscope is to measure the voltage dropped across a shunt resistor.

Can we measure current using oscilloscope?

Most oscilloscopes only directly measure voltage, not current, however you can measure current with an oscilloscope, using one of two methods. One technique is to measure the differential voltage drop across such a resistor. These are generally low-value resistors, often smaller than 1 Ohm.

Can you use a battery powered oscilloscope to measure voltage?

Generally, the hand-held, battery-powered oscilloscope is a viable solution for making measurements where both sides of the circuit float above the ground plane. Besides the voltage hazard in using a grounded bench-type oscilloscope, there are other situations that can damage the instrument and/or harm the user.

What are the disadvantages of using a bench oscilloscope?

The bench oscilloscope is more vulnerable to moisture than a hand-held model, in part because of the metal case with open venting, and in part because of the higher supply voltage. Moisture causes degradation of electrical insulation, particularly in the power supply transformer.
